EX-99.1 2 a5081984ex99_1.txt EXHIBIT 99.1 EXHIBIT 99.1 Network Appliance Announces Results for Third Quarter Fiscal Year 2006; Achieves 30% Year-over-Year Revenue Growth SUNNYVALE, Calif.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Feb. 15, 2006--Network Appliance, Inc. (NASDAQ:NTAP), the leader in advanced networked storage solutions, today reported results for the third quarter of fiscal year 2006. Revenues for the third fiscal quarter were $537.0 million, an increase of 30% compared to revenues of $412.7 million for the same period a year ago and an increase of 11% compared to $483.1 million in the prior quarter. For the third fiscal quarter, GAAP net income was $76.4 million, or $0.20 per share(1) compared to GAAP net income of $60.1 million, or $0.16 per share for the same period in the prior year. Non-GAAP(2) net income for the third fiscal quarter increased 35% to $84.7 million, or $0.22 per share, compared to non-GAAP net income of $62.8 million, or $0.16 per share for the same period a year ago. Revenues for the first nine months of the current fiscal year totaled $1.5 billion, compared to revenues of $1.1 billion for the first nine months of the prior fiscal year, an increase of 28% year over year. For the first nine months of the current fiscal year, GAAP net income increased 28% to $207.2 million, or $0.54 per share, compared with GAAP net income of $162.3 million, or $0.43 per share for the same period in the prior year. Non-GAAP net income for the first nine months of the current fiscal year increased 32% to $226.0 million, or $0.58 per share, compared to non-GAAP net income of $171.1 million, or $0.45 per share for the first nine months of the prior fiscal year. Outlook -- Network Appliance estimates that year-over-year growth in revenue for the fourth quarter of fiscal year 2006 will be in the range of 28% to 30%. -- The company expects fourth quarter GAAP earnings per share to finish between $0.20 and $0.21 per share. Network Appliance expects fourth quarter non-GAAP earnings per share to be in the range of $0.22 to $0.23 per share. -- For the full fiscal year, Network Appliance estimates that revenues will finish in the range of 28% to 29% higher than fiscal year 2005. -- The company expects GAAP earnings per share for fiscal year 2006 to be between $0.73 and $0.74 per share. Network Appliance estimates full-year non-GAAP earnings per share to be in the range of $0.80 to $0.81 per share. Quarterly Highlights This quarter, NetApp(R) was listed in the "leader" quadrant for midrange enterprise disk arrays in Gartner's research note, "Magic Quadrant for Midrange Enterprise Disk Array, 2H05."(3) NetApp SAN solutions provide an unmatched combination of high-performance, robustness, and ease-of-use for Windows(R), Solaris(R), HP/UX, IBM AIX, and Linux(R) computing platforms. Also this quarter, according to IDC's Worldwide Quarterly Disk Storage Systems Tracker Q3 2005(4), NetApp demonstrated continued leadership in the iSCSI storage market, with number-one market share in capacity shipped (38.4%) and revenue (35.1%). NetApp maintained leadership in its core NAS market, with a 44.3% capacity share. Of the vendors tracked, NetApp posted the strongest year-over-year increase in FC SAN revenue, with a growth rate of 118%. Also according to IDC, NetApp experienced the fastest growth among the top five vendors in storage software with 49.4% year-over-year growth from Q2 2004 to Q2 2005 versus a market growth rate of 11.8% for the same period. Total NetApp market share in storage software grew from 5% in Q2 2004 to 6.6% in Q2 2005. The Company refers to the non-GAAP financial measures cited above in making operating decisions because they provide meaningful supplemental information regarding the Company's operational performance. These non-GAAP financial measures exclude amortization of intangible assets, in process research and development, stock compensation, restructuring charges/recoveries, net gain/loss on investments and the related effects on income taxes, as well as certain discrete GAAP provision for income tax matters recognized ratably for non-GAAP purposes. We have excluded these items because they derive from unusual events that are not attributable to normal on-going operations and thus makes it more difficult for an investor to understand our recurring operational performance. The use of these non-GAAP financial measures has material limitations because they should not be used to evaluate our company without reference to their corresponding GAAP financial measures. As such, we compensate for these material limitations by using these non-GAAP financial measures in conjunction with GAAP financial measures. These non-GAAP financial measures facilitate management's internal comparisons to the Company's historical operating results and comparisons to competitors' operating results. We include these non-GAAP financial measures in our earnings announcement because we believe they are useful to investors in allowing for greater transparency with respect to supplemental information used by management in its financial and operational decision making such as employee compensation planning. In addition, we have historically reported similar non-GAAP financial measures to our investors and believe that the inclusion of comparative numbers provides consistency in our financial reporting at this time.
